Details
A vulnerability was found in Lenovo XClarity Controller (version unknown). It has been classified as critical. This affects an unknown function of the component XCC Web User Interface. The manipulation with an unknown input leads to a format string vulnerability. CWE is classifying the issue as CWE-134. The product uses a function that accepts a format string as an argument, but the format string originates from an external source. This is going to have an impact on confidentiality, integrity, and availability. The summary by CVE is:
A valid, authenticated user may be able to trigger a denial of service of the XCC web user interface or other undefined behavior through a format string injection vulnerability in a web interface API.
The weakness was disclosed 05/01/2023. It is possible to read the advisory at support.lenovo.com. This vulnerability is uniquely identified as CVE-2023-25492 since 02/06/2023. The technical details are unknown and an exploit is not publicly available.
Upgrading eliminates this vulnerability.
